Peter de Haig, lord of Bemersyde, grants to God, the church of St Mary of Dryburgh and the canons serving God there, that whole part of his grove of Flatwood etc.

Omnibus hoc scriptum etc. Petrus de Haga dominus de Bemersyd salutem in Domino . Noveritis me divine pietatis intuitu et pro salute anime mee et Katerine sponse mee {. . .} dedisse concessisse et hac presenti carta confirmasse Deo et ecclesie sancte Marie de Driburgh et canonicis ibidem Deo servientibus et inperpetuum servituris totam illam partem nemoris mei de Flatwod {. . .}
